]> Cypherpunks repositories - gostls13.git/commit
src/vendor,crypto/tls: update to latest x/crypto and use new X25519 API
authorFilippo Valsorda <filippo@golang.org>
Tue, 12 Nov 2019 01:37:50 +0000 (20:37 -0500)
committerFilippo Valsorda <filippo@golang.org>
Wed, 13 Nov 2019 01:15:54 +0000 (01:15 +0000)
commit43ec1b12f50b9ec6edefb39a9e11226ea68d7757
tree02e3acfa19162327389107aa243b69c7ca676d51
parent995ade86e3900a9d6b983c2669f9b5761fc349bf
src/vendor,crypto/tls: update to latest x/crypto and use new X25519 API

Change-Id: Icd5006e37861d892a5f3d4397c3826179c1b12ad
Reviewed-on: https://go-review.googlesource.com/c/go/+/206657
Run-TryBot: Filippo Valsorda <filippo@golang.org>
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Katie Hockman <katie@golang.org>
46 files changed:
src/crypto/tls/key_schedule.go
src/go.mod
src/go.sum
src/vendor/golang.org/x/crypto/chacha20/chacha_arm64.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/chacha20/chacha_arm64.s [moved from src/vendor/golang.org/x/crypto/internal/chacha20/asm_arm64.s with 100% similarity]
src/vendor/golang.org/x/crypto/chacha20/chacha_generic.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/chacha20/chacha_noasm.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/chacha20/chacha_ppc64le.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/chacha20/chacha_ppc64le.s [new file with mode: 0644]
src/vendor/golang.org/x/crypto/chacha20/chacha_s390x.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/chacha20/chacha_s390x.s [moved from src/vendor/golang.org/x/crypto/internal/chacha20/chacha_s390x.s with 87% similarity]
src/vendor/golang.org/x/crypto/chacha20/xor.go [moved from src/vendor/golang.org/x/crypto/internal/chacha20/xor.go with 98% similarity]
src/vendor/golang.org/x/crypto/chacha20poly1305/chacha20poly1305.go
src/vendor/golang.org/x/crypto/chacha20poly1305/chacha20poly1305_amd64.go
src/vendor/golang.org/x/crypto/chacha20poly1305/chacha20poly1305_generic.go
src/vendor/golang.org/x/crypto/chacha20poly1305/xchacha20poly1305.go
src/vendor/golang.org/x/crypto/curve25519/const_amd64.h [deleted file]
src/vendor/golang.org/x/crypto/curve25519/const_amd64.s [deleted file]
src/vendor/golang.org/x/crypto/curve25519/cswap_amd64.s [deleted file]
src/vendor/golang.org/x/crypto/curve25519/curve25519.go
src/vendor/golang.org/x/crypto/curve25519/curve25519_amd64.go [moved from src/vendor/golang.org/x/crypto/curve25519/mont25519_amd64.go with 99% similarity]
src/vendor/golang.org/x/crypto/curve25519/curve25519_amd64.s [moved from src/vendor/golang.org/x/crypto/curve25519/ladderstep_amd64.s with 76% similarity]
src/vendor/golang.org/x/crypto/curve25519/curve25519_generic.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/curve25519/curve25519_noasm.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/curve25519/doc.go [deleted file]
src/vendor/golang.org/x/crypto/curve25519/freeze_amd64.s [deleted file]
src/vendor/golang.org/x/crypto/curve25519/mul_amd64.s [deleted file]
src/vendor/golang.org/x/crypto/curve25519/square_amd64.s [deleted file]
src/vendor/golang.org/x/crypto/internal/chacha20/asm_ppc64le.s [deleted file]
src/vendor/golang.org/x/crypto/internal/chacha20/chacha_arm64.go [deleted file]
src/vendor/golang.org/x/crypto/internal/chacha20/chacha_generic.go [deleted file]
src/vendor/golang.org/x/crypto/internal/chacha20/chacha_noasm.go [deleted file]
src/vendor/golang.org/x/crypto/internal/chacha20/chacha_ppc64le.go [deleted file]
src/vendor/golang.org/x/crypto/internal/chacha20/chacha_s390x.go [deleted file]
src/vendor/golang.org/x/crypto/poly1305/bits_compat.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/poly1305/bits_go1.13.go [new file with mode: 0644]
src/vendor/golang.org/x/crypto/poly1305/poly1305.go
src/vendor/golang.org/x/crypto/poly1305/sum_amd64.go
src/vendor/golang.org/x/crypto/poly1305/sum_amd64.s
src/vendor/golang.org/x/crypto/poly1305/sum_arm.go
src/vendor/golang.org/x/crypto/poly1305/sum_generic.go
src/vendor/golang.org/x/crypto/poly1305/sum_noasm.go
src/vendor/golang.org/x/crypto/poly1305/sum_ppc64le.go
src/vendor/golang.org/x/crypto/poly1305/sum_ppc64le.s
src/vendor/golang.org/x/crypto/poly1305/sum_s390x.go
src/vendor/modules.txt